Wilson's disease presenting with rapidly progressive visual loss: another neurologic manifestation of Wilson's disease?
Wilson's disease (WD) is a rare autosomal recessive disorder of copper metabolism resulting in copper-induced tissue damage that primarily involves the liver and central nervous system. The neurologic manifestations of WD almost universally involve a derangement of basal ganglia function or psy...
